for the amount of current they can handle. But i don't know if that is such a good sounding thing. In my amp as driver tube, which is not the same as a pass tube in a CD player, they sounded "dark" and by that the highs were somewhat recessed compared to the lows. But the 7119 had a better frequency spread with no frequency dominating any other.
